우분투 12.04LTS에서 창을 사용하여 만든 PHP 프로젝트를 실행하려고합니다. 그래서 우분투 시스템에 php5 apache2와 open_jdk_7을 설치했습니다. 다음 단계는 var/www/webserver 디렉토리에 프로젝트 (파일 index.php, 디렉토리 CSS 및 기타 파일 및 디렉토리)를 넣는 것입니다. 그럼 난 파이어 폭스를 열고 myip/weserver/index.php 썼습니다. 실제로 페이지를로드했지만 CSS를 사용하지 않았습니다. 그런데 우분투에서 나는 새로운 것이므로 가능한 한 간단하게 유지하십시오 : /. 어떤 도움이라도 대단히 감사하겠습니다. CSS는 우분투 12.04에서 PHP 프로젝트에 사용되지 않습니다
이
내가 index.php를<?php
define("SUBFOLDER","");
//has to be changed to DOCUMENT ROOT
define("ROOT","C:\webdev\apache\htdocs");
?>
<head>
<meta charset="utf-8">
<meta http-equiv="X-UA-Compatible" content="IE=edge,chrome=1">
<meta name="viewport" content="width=device-width, initial-scale=1.0">
<link href="<?php echo SUBFOLDER."/"; ?>css/myCSSfile.css" rel="stylesheet" type="text/css">
<link rel="shortcut icon" href="<?php echo SUBFOLDER."/"; ?>images/dit.ico">
<link rel="stylesheet" href="<?php echo SUBFOLDER."/"; ?>css/search.css">
<link rel="stylesheet" href="<?php echo SUBFOLDER."/"; ?>css/button.css">
<link rel="stylesheet" href="<?php echo SUBFOLDER."/"; ?>css/button2.css">
<script type="text/javascript" src="<?php echo SUBFOLDER."/"; ?>js/resolutionfinder.js"></script>
<script type="text/javascript" src="<?php echo SUBFOLDER."/"; ?>js/changeInputValue.js"></script>
<script src="//ajax.googleapis.com/ajax/libs/jquery/1.7.1/jquery.min.js"></script>
<script type="text/javascript" src="<?php echo SUBFOLDER."/"; ?>js/ajaxcalls.js"></script>
의 윈도우 버전에 사용되는 코드 그쪽의 시작 부분입니다 그리고 이것은 내가 두 번째 리눅스에서 사용하는 정의 변경하는 방법입니다. 어쩌면 나는 루트 경로를 틀리게 줄까?
<?php
define("SUBFOLDER","/webserver");
//has to be changed to DOCUMENT ROOT
define("ROOT","/var/www/webserver");
?>
<head>
<meta charset="utf-8">
<meta http-equiv="X-UA-Compatible" content="IE=edge,chrome=1">
<meta name="viewport" content="width=device-width, initial-scale=1.0">
<link href="<?php echo SUBFOLDER."/"; ?>css/myCSSfile.css" rel="stylesheet" type="text/css">
<link rel="shortcut icon" href="<?php echo SUBFOLDER."/"; ?>images/dit.ico">
<link rel="stylesheet" href="<?php echo SUBFOLDER."/"; ?>css/search.css">
<link rel="stylesheet" href="<?php echo SUBFOLDER."/"; ?>css/button.css">
<link rel="stylesheet" href="<?php echo SUBFOLDER."/"; ?>css/button2.css">
<script type="text/javascript" src="<?php echo SUBFOLDER."/"; ?>js/resolutionfinder.js"></script>
<script type="text/javascript" src="<?php echo SUBFOLDER."/"; ?>js/changeInputValue.js"></script>
<script src="//ajax.googleapis.com/ajax/libs/jquery/1.7.1/jquery.min.js"></script>
<script type="text/javascript" src="<?php echo SUBFOLDER."/"; ?>js/ajaxcalls.js"></script>
CSS 파일에 대한 올바른 경로가없는 것 같습니다. 파일 구성 방법을 보여주고 HTML을 게시하십시오. – Barmar
파일 css는 index.php (www 폴더에 있음)와 같은 폴더에 있습니다. –
올바른 것처럼 보입니다. 웹 콘솔에 오류가 표시됩니까? – Barmar